Do the Giants still have to pay Odell Beckham?

The trade of Beckham will put added scrutiny on the Giants decision-making in next month's draft and during the free agency period. Beckham's departure seems a strong indication that the team is girding for a period of rebuilding and will no longer be chasing a playoff berth in 2019, or perhaps even beyond next season.
